The cost of consulting a private psychiatrist in the UK can vary widely, depending on numerous factors, including the psychiatrist's experience, the area of their practice, and the specific services required. Usually, initial evaluations may v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500, while follow-up assessments can cost in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 350. Lots of private psychiatrists charge on a per-session basis, but some might provide package offers for ongoing treatment.
Average Costs OverviewServiceTypical Cost (GBP)Initial Consultation₤ 150 - ₤ 500Follow-Up Consultation₤ 100 - ₤ 350Psychotherapy Sessions₤ 50 - ₤ 150 per sessionMedication ManagementConsisted of in assessment fee
It is likewise necessary to consider that some private treatment plans may not be covered by insurance, so it is suggested to inspect with your insurance company before seeking private care.

What credentials should a private psychiatrist have?
Private psychiatrists ought to hold a medical degree, total specialized training in psychiatry, and be registered with the General Medical Council (GMC).
2. For how long does a normal assessment last?
An initial consultation generally lasts between 60 to 90 minutes, while follow-up consultations might take roughly 30 to 60 minutes.
3. Can private psychiatrists recommend medication?
Yes, private psychiatrists are certified medical physicians and can prescribe medications as part of the treatment plan.
4. Is private psychiatric treatment covered by insurance coverage?
This depends on the insurance provider and the particular policy. It's suggested to consult the insurance company ahead of time.
5. What should I anticipate during my very first appointment?
During the very first appointment, the psychiatrist will conduct an assessment, discuss your issues, and overview possible treatment choices.
